
CTF-Reverse
文章平均质量分 73
本专栏记录本人从最开始做CTF逆向题的WP,题目来源于攻防世界,BUUCTF,ctf.show等各大平台,也会记录本人比赛中的题目
Shad0w-2023
要想人前显贵,必先人后受罪!!!
展开
-
BUUCTF-REVERSE-rome
这里大概看了一下,最开始输入的必须是ACTF,然后有一个v12字符串,然后是将我们输入的字符串进行加密,加密后与v12比较,但是往上面看一下,我们输入的貌似只有4个字符?只是一个让我们输入,那大概就是将字符串解密了。然后这里的v12[17]应该是循环次数i。包上flag{},就ok了。原创 2023-07-05 10:10:09 · 164 阅读 · 0 评论 -
【BUUCTF-REVERSE刮开有奖】详解版
这是Base64加密的码表,那么我们就可以合理地猜测:该函数就是将String中的三个字符进行Base64加密,了解Base64加密的应该知道,加密后应该是4个字符。我们可以看到,String[1]就是v7加密后的第一个字符+3,但是这里要非常注意,这里的3不是数字3,而是ASCII码的3,是51。而String[3],String[4],String[5]由于是Base64加密,这里将V1Ax解密就好,解密后为。String[6],String[7],String[8]也一样,将ak1w解密,解密后为。原创 2023-07-04 16:43:21 · 317 阅读 · 0 评论 -
花指令的原理,花指令的分析方法
在我们逆向分析的过程中,经常会受到花指令的干扰,今天我就来带领大家了解了解花指令。原创 2023-07-03 20:25:21 · 1255 阅读 · 0 评论 -
【IDA疑难杂症修复】
我们在使用IDA进行逆向分析的时候,会遇到一些问题,这篇文章来带领大家学习IDA中疑难杂症的修复:函数大小限制,栈不平衡,switch无法识别(跳转表修复),ida Decompile as call。原创 2023-07-03 12:23:34 · 2652 阅读 · 0 评论 -
【CTF-Reverse】IDA动态调试,反调试技术
在本专栏前两篇文章中,带领大家讲解了逆向加密算法,AES,TEA,RC4,Base64加密算法,并带领大家识别各种密码算法特征,这一篇文章来带领大家学习在逆向过程中的动态调试:IDA动态调试,反调试技术。原创 2023-06-27 10:04:09 · 3993 阅读 · 1 评论 -
【CTF-Reverse中的加密算法】密码算法特征识别,变种密码算法分析
上一章中我们带领大家了解了加密算法——RC4,TEA,Base64算法的原理,但是加密算法远不止这些,需要大家自行去学习,在这一章中,我来带领大家了解密码算法特征识别,变种密码算法分析。原创 2023-06-26 11:47:51 · 1014 阅读 · 0 评论 -
【CTF-Reverse中的加密算法】RC4,TEA和Base 64加密算法
在我们做CTF逆向题目的时候,数据结构可谓是最基础的东西了,有很多题目都是逆向算法题目,所以好的算法能力对我们打CTF比赛还是很有帮助的,今天就来带领大家了解一下加密算法RC4,TEA和Base 64。原创 2023-06-25 09:50:29 · 4455 阅读 · 0 评论 -
BUUCTF--reverse1,reverse2--WP
BUUCTF--reverse1,这道题目也是非常简单,主要考察IDA Pro的使用,分析代码:发现是64位exe,直接拖到IDA Pro中,发现没有找到主函数:原创 2023-05-13 17:31:22 · 1098 阅读 · 5 评论 -
BUUCTF--Reverse--easyre(非常简单的逆向)WP
这道题目非常简单,发现是64位exe,直接拖到IDA Pro中即可看到flag,在WinHex中直接查找字符串也可以得到。原创 2023-05-13 17:12:22 · 903 阅读 · 2 评论